Mississippi Becomes 12th State to Legalize DFS Betting

Mississippi has grow to be the first US state to pass day-to-day fantasy sports activities (DFS) legislation in 2017, and 1 of only a dozen states general given that Virginia pioneered the way back in March 2016. The listing of other states which have also regulated the on-line game includes Colorado, Indiana, Kansas, Maryland, Massachusetts, Missouri, New York, Rhode Island, Tennessee, West Virginia, and Virginia.

Moreover, a complete of 22 states now have DFS regulation in spot, or are critically contemplating introducing payments, with just 5 states openly banning the game, namely Arizona, Iowa, Louisiana, Montana, and Washington.

In January, Mississippi State Rep. Richard Bennett introduced his piece of legislation called HB 967, which then sailed by way of the two the state Property and Senate, before getting signed into law on March 13th by state Governor Phil Bryant (photo). HB 967 is subsequently expected to officially turn into law on July 1st.

In accordance to HB 967, those operators applying for a allow will have to spend a minimum of $5,000 for a three-year license, with all candidates being screened, and audited annually. They will also be taxed at a rate of 8% on their net revenues, which in accordance to the bill, is defined as  the complete of all fantasy contest entry costs that an operator collects from all players, less the total of all sums paid out as money prizes.

It is hoped that Mississippi's ailing economy will be aided by the game's legalization, with some estimates putting its yearly projections at around $5 million. However, taking into consideration the Magnolia State's yearly budget is $6 billion, DFS regulation is probably to be of only any genuine advantage to those who take pleasure in taking part in the game.
